What is Djay Pro?
Djay Pro is a professional DJ software developed by Algoriddim. It allows users to mix and play music using their computer, with features such as beatmatching, effects, and sampling. The software is available for Windows and macOS and is widely used by DJs and music producers.

Risks associated with using cracked software
Using cracked software, including Djay Pro cracked Windows, poses several risks:
- Malware and viruses: Cracked software often comes with malware or viruses that can harm the user's computer or compromise their personal data.
- Security vulnerabilities: Cracked software may have security vulnerabilities that can be exploited by hackers, putting the user's data at risk.
- No support or updates: Cracked software often does not come with support or updates, which means that users may encounter bugs or issues that cannot be resolved.
- Unstable performance: Cracked software may not perform stably, leading to crashes, errors, or other issues that can affect the user's workflow.

The Hidden Dangers of Cracked DJ Software
Let’s cut through the hype. When you search for a cracked version of Djay Pro for Windows, you are entering one of the riskiest corners of the internet. Here’s what cybersecurity experts want you to know:
1. Malware and Ransomware Attacks Cracked software is a favorite delivery method for malware. When you download a "keygen," "patch," or "crack," you’re often getting much more than a disabled license check. Common infections include:
- Keyloggers: Recording every keystroke—including your passwords, DJ account logins, and banking details.
- Cryptominers: Using your CPU and GPU to mine cryptocurrency, slowing your DJ performance to a crawl.
- Ransomware: Encrypting your music library, mixes, and project files, then demanding payment to unlock them.
2. No Updates, No Bug Fixes Djay Pro regularly releases updates to fix crashes, improve audio latency, and add new hardware support for controllers like the Pioneer DDJ or Numark devices. A cracked version cannot be updated. You’ll be stuck with an outdated, buggy version that may crash mid-set at a gig.
3. Missing Core Features Cracked versions often break key integrations. For example, legitimate Djay Pro for Windows supports:
- Neural Mix™ (real-time stem separation for vocals, drums, and instruments)
- External audio mixer support
- iCloud sync (for playlists between Mac and Windows)
- Tidal, SoundCloud Go+, and Beatport LINK integration
Cracked versions typically cannot access these cloud services, rendering the software half-functional.
4. Legal Consequences Software piracy is a civil offense in most countries. While individual users are rarely sued, fines can range from $500 to $150,000 per infringed work under the Copyright Act. Additionally, your ISP may terminate your service if they detect repeated piracy traffic.
5. No Technical Support When your audio driver fails minutes before a live stream or wedding reception, the crack provider won’t answer your call. Legitimate users get access to Algoriddim’s support team, knowledge base, and community forums.
Why DJs Target Djay Pro on Windows
Understanding the demand helps explain why “cracked” searches exist. Djay Pro offers unique advantages over competitors like Serato DJ Lite, Traktor Pro, or VirtualDJ:
- Neural Mix Technology: AI-powered real-time stem separation (isolate vocals, drums, or instruments from any track) without pre-analysis.
- Hardware Compatibility: Works with over 100 MIDI controllers, including Pioneer DJ, Numark, Reloop, and Denon.
- 4-Decks & Video Mixing: Two extra decks for acapellas or samples, plus video mixing for VJs.
- Windows Optimization: Native ASIO driver support for low latency on Windows 10 and 11.
